Inquiridor
Cancelamentos não constam no arquivo final, nota fiscal paulista.

Pergunta
-
Tenho um cliente que usa uma impressora matricial MP20-FI-II versão 03.30, e está acontecendo algo curioso com os cancelamentos.
Nas reduções Z, e nas leituras de memória fiscal, constam os cancelamentos tudo em ordem, como manda o figurino, mas......
no arquivo gerado para a nota fiscal paulista, consta o valor dos cancelamentos no registro E13, porém nos registros E14,E15 e E21 não constam os cupons cancelados. Pelo que eu sei, eles deveriam constar, porém com o indicador de cupom cancelado "S" em determinada posição, mas não está acontecendo. O cupom sequer é mencionado.
As versões das DLL´s usadas são as mais recentes, sem sombra de dúvida.
Meu aplicativo se comunica com o ECF, pura e simplesmente atravéz da DLL.
No mês de dezembro houve o mesmo problema. Enviei para o suporte da Bematech os arquivos, mas a orientação que recebí, foi que se não obtivesse êxito com as versões atualizadas das dll´s, teria que gerar os arquivos manualmente.
Detalhe: Não estava lá pra conferir, mas, acredito que todos os cancelamentos foram feitos com o cupom fiscal ainda aberto.
Para este mês, orientei o cliente a cancelar cupons, somente após encerrá-los com as formas de pagamento. Vamos ver o que acontece.
Todas as Respostas
-
Boa tarde Junior,
Este problemas de cancelamento do cupom ocorria em uma versão antiga da DLL da Bematech. Orientamos que atualize os arquivos.
Ja sobre a correção, realemente não é possível fazer esta correção pela DLL, por isso foi indicado a fazer manualmente o processo.
link: http://www.bematech.com.br/suporte/downloads/fisc_win/BemaFI32.zip
Iohannes Nakatani
Suporte ao Desenvolvedor Bematech
0800 644 2362
suporte@bematech.com.br
suporte.iohannes@bematech.com.br
MSN: suporte.iohannes@bematech.com.br
Skype: Suporte.Iohannes -
Orientamos que atualize os arquivos.
Não entendeu.
As DLL´s já foram todas atualizadas no mês de janeiro, porém o problema persiste.
Simplesmente os cupons que foram cancelados, não figuram no arquivo final.
E sendo assim, terei que fazer a correção manualmente até quando ???
É sabido que o fabricante do ecf não tem a obrigação de disponibilizar tal arquivo, mas em se tratando da Bematech, e já que foi disponibilizada a função, porquê não fazer direito ?
Aliás o problema parece estar na dll que gera o arquivo RFD, uma vez que gerando o arquivo pelo WinMFD2, ocorre o mesmo problema. O que nos leva a entender que o problema está na geração do arquivo RFD.
-
Bom dia Junior,
Vamos fazer o seguinte, me envie os arquivos de Log da DLL para que eu possa analisar o ocorrido, pois foi identificado este problema em uma versão antiga da DLL, e em todos os cliente que enviamos esta nova versão da DLL não ocorreu mais este erro.
Preciso destas informações para resolver este problema o mais rapido possível.
Iohannes Nakatani
Suporte ao Desenvolvedor Bematech
0800 644 2362
suporte@bematech.com.br
suporte.iohannes@bematech.com.br
MSN: suporte.iohannes@bematech.com.br
Skype: Suporte.Iohannes